Page 1 of 1

创建和查询数据

Posted: Mon Feb 10, 2025 6:58 am
by jrineakter
如果您有 SQL 经验,那么 SurrealDB 会让您感觉非常轻松。以下是一个小例子:




这就是事情变得真正有趣的地方。 SurrealDB 允许您简单地将记录 ID 存储在其他记录中,而无需使用复杂的连接。查询可能如下所示:

SELECT name, posts.title FROM person:john;
此查询不仅检索了 John 的名字,还检索了他所有帖子的标题 - 无需任何连接!

为什么 SurrealDB 可能是未来
简单:SurrealDB简化了复杂的数据库操作,因此您可以专注于应用程序逻辑。

性能:通过消除连接并使用高效的数据访问策略,SurrealDB 提供了令人印象深刻的性能。

灵活性:从无模式到严格类型,SurrealDB 可以适应您的需求。

可扩展性:无需从根本上改变架构即可从单个服务器扩展到全局分布式数据库。

面向未来:通过支持关系、文档和图形数据模型,SurrealDB 已准备好应对未来的挑战。

结论:SurrealDB 是否好得令人难以置信?
SurrealDB 承诺了很多 - 如果你愿意的话,它是数据 阿富汗 WhatsApp 数据 库领域的万事通。到目前为止,她似乎正在履行这个承诺。当然,她还年轻,必须在现实世界中证明自己。但有一点很清楚:SurrealDB 有可能从根本上改变我们思考和使用数据库的方式。

无论您是经验丰富的数据库管理员,还是刚刚进入数据处理领域,SurrealDB 绝对值得仔细研究。也许这正是您一直在寻找的解决方案。

常问问题
问题:SurrealDB 适合生产环境吗? 答:尽管 SurrealDB 很有前景,但重要的是要记住它是一项相对较新的技术。对于关键的生产环境,您应该仔细考虑并尽可能首先在不太重要的区域进行测试。

问题:我可以将现有的 SQL 知识应用到 SurrealDB 吗? 答:当然了! SurrealDB 使用类似 SQL 的查询语言,如果您以前使用过 SQL,它会显得非常熟悉。然而,有一些差异和扩展是专门针对 SurrealDB 的多模型特性而定制的。

问:与专用数据库相比,SurrealDB 的性能如何? 答:SurrealDB 的性能在很多场景下都令人印象深刻,特别是在处理复杂关系时。然而,在非常具体的用例中,专门的数据库可能仍然具有优势。始终建议针对您的特定用例运行基准测试。